Nani targets Manchester United first-team spot

Nani says that he wants to hold down a regular starting place with Manchester United.

Manchester United winger Nani is eyeing a regular spot in the first team this season.

The Portuguese international has been limited in terms of starts for the Premier League champions and was linked with a move away from Old Trafford in the summer.

However, having recently signed a new five-year deal with the club, Nani is hoping that he can become a regular feature of the starting lineup.

"I am very content with my new deal at Manchester United," Nani told the Daily Mirror. "This summer was not easy but after a lot of thought and talking to [manager] David Moyes I believe it was the best solution.

"I feel I can offer many things to United. I had other important offers but without a sufficient challenge to make me want to leave United.

"The coach would not guarantee me a place in the XI more than any other player. I know I must work hard to get into this team. That is my objective for this season."

United host Crystal Palace on Saturday.
